Maintaining focus in the workplace can be challenging, especially with the constant barrage of distractions from emails, social media, and colleagues. However, by implementing a few simple strategies, you can significantly improve your concentration and productivity.
Here are 10 tips to help you stay focused at work:
1.Eliminate distractions: One of the biggest challenges to focus is the constant presence of distractions. To minimize distractions, turn off notifications on your phone and computer, close unnecessary tabs on your browser, and work in a quiet space. If you work in an open office, consider using Noise cancelling headphones to block out background noise.
2.Prioritize your tasks: Not all tasks are created equal. Some are more important and urgent than others. To ensure you're working on the most important tasks first, create a to-do list and prioritize your items. Once you know what needs to be done, you can set realistic deadlines and focus on one task at a time.
3.Set realistic goals: Setting unrealistic goals can set you up for failure and frustration. Instead, break down large projects into smaller, more manageable tasks. This will make the work seem less daunting and help you stay motivated.
4.Take breaks: Working for extended periods without a break can lead to mental fatigue and decreased focus. Take short breaks throughout the day to get up and move around, stretch, or do something you enjoy. This will help you refresh your mind and come back to your work with renewed focus.
5.Get enough sleep: When you're well-rested, you have better concentration and focus. Aim for 7-8 hours of sleep each night to improve your cognitive function.
6.Eat healthy foods: Eating a healthy diet can help improve your overall brain health and cognitive function. Avoid processed foods and sugary drinks, and focus on eating plenty of fruits, vegetables, and whole grains.
7.Exercise regularly: Exercise has been shown to improve cognitive function and reduce stress levels.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ise most days of the week.
8.Practice mindfulness: Mindfulness techniques, such as meditation, can help improve your focus and concentration. There are many different mindfulness apps and resources available online.
9.Use productivity tools: There are a number of productivity tools available that can help you stay focused and organized. Some popular tools include time tracking software, to-do list apps, and project management software.
10.Reward yourself: When you achieve a goal or complete a task, take some time to reward yourself. This will help you stay motivated and make work more enjoyable.
By following these tips, you can improve your focus and productivity at work. Remember, it takes time and effort to develop good habits, so be patient with yourself and keep practicing.
